Euclid's Elements Book 1, Proposition 14
Project Euclid presents Euclid's Elements, Book 1, Proposition 14 "If with any straight line, and at a point on it, two straight lines not lying on the same side make the sum of the adjacent angles equal to two right angles, then the two straight lines are in a straight line with one another."
